Managed Markets Analytics and Operations Associate Director
Company Summary: This is a vital and strategic role in our growth team and will report to the Director of Managed Markets Operations, Pricing and Analytics, US Managed Markets. Looking for a self-starter that can quickly understand complex situations and generate effective solutions. This position is a key liaison with GIS (IT) to help streamline the Managed Markets data and analytics enablement process. The individual will influence, negotiate, and maintain relationships with stakeholders at all organizational levels.
The Managed Markets Analytics and Operations AD will be responsible for:
-Directs the advancement of key projects to cultivate reports and dashboards that will be used for providing strategic insight to senior leadership for decision making
-Offer strategic insights related to key drivers of gross-to-net through proactive research and analysis of various data sources, industry publications and engagement of internal/external stakeholders as it relates to payer and segment mix, business intelligence dashboards, reporting and related analytics
-Optimize analytics and data to the Specialty Pharmacy and Specialty Distributor field teams managing the 3PL and Distributor relationships
-Consistently seek out new data assets, technologies, and tools; follow opportunities to automate recurring deliverables to allow for scaling and efficiency of processes
-Collaborator with a vendor to create and sustain dashboards and guide the design process, translating from business stakeholders to the final dashboard or reporting solution.
The Managed Markets Analytics and Operations AD should have the following qualifications:
-A Bachelor's degree (Master's degree preferred)
-8+ years of experience in the pharmaceutical or biotech industry, 6+ years of insights, analytics and reporting is required
-Demonstrated job experience that includes combined a mix of disciplines such as strategy development, business analysis, process management, operations, and systems analysis
-Exceptional analytics and technical data skills with experience creating and/or supporting complex models
-This is a Boston based position with the candidate to be able to be in the office 2-3 days/week
